Inphi Corporation, a high-speed analog semiconductor company, today introduced its 4336TA Transimpedance Amplifier (TIA) for next-generation Small Form-Factor 40 Gbps Very Short Reach (VSR) transponder modules. The new 4336TA is a high-gain TIA that enables transponders to achieve high-sensitivity and high-overload performance over a wide range of temperatures and supply voltages. As a result, Inphi helps its customers simplify the design, production and installation of 40 Gbps serial components and equipment. The new 4336TA component will be shown at OFC/NFOEC 2010 in San Diego, March 23-25. Engineering samples of the 4336TA are available immediately.

SiFotonics™ Technologies Co., Ltd., a leading supplier of optical communications components based on the Silicon Photonics technology platform, announced on Monday March 22, 2010 that the TP1001, an integrated receiver for 2.5Gb/s optical communication applications is available for volume production. The TP1001 receiver consists of a strained Germanium detector monolithically integrated with a trans-impedance amplifier (TIA) fabricated on an 8-inch Silicon wafer. The fabrication was successfully conducted at two of the leading global semiconductor foundries.
